Overview
This Industrial Engineering and International Management programme from the Fresenius University centers on the major engineering issues of our time, such as the use of AI and the development of circular economy and smart technologies. During your studies, you will acquire not only the skills required to optimize processes, solve problems, and professionally represent international manufacturing and engineering companies, but also gain the knowledge needed to develop technical solutions to the economic, social and environmental challenges of our global society.
Career
The Industrial Engineering and International Management from Fresenius University of Applied Sciences has been developed in alignment with the German Qualifications Framework for Industrial Engineers (Qualifikationsrahmen Wirtschaftsingeneurwesen), ensuring that you receive a qualification recognized by the industry to kickstart your career.
Upon completing your master’s studies, you will be equipped to perform management tasks in the manufacturing and technology sectors, assume budget and staffing responsibilities, and provide strategic solutions. You will be qualified to work in both national and international companies, take on leadership roles, and collaborate as part of international and interdisciplinary teams to develop and manage engineering solutions.

Other requirements
General requirements
- You must have completed a Bachelor’s study program in engineering, industrial engineering, or a related subject from a STEM discipline (Science, Technology, Engineering, Mathematics) with at least 180 credit points.
- In order to meet the requirements of the German Qualifications Framework for Industrial Engineering (Qualifikationsrahmen Wirtschaftsingenieurwesen), successful you must demonstrate the following minimum requirements from your Bachelor’s program:
- 60 credit points in STEM subjects (Science, Technology, Engineering, Mathematics)
- 10 credit points business or management
- 10 credit points thesis or project
- Your English language skills must be equivalent to Level B2 of the European Framework of Reference for Languages.
